Anniversaries always feel like milestones, even if you’ve been with your partner for 20 years now. So, it’s only natural to celebrate them.

However, life sometimes gets so hectic that we forget about even having an anniversary to celebrate – not to mention buying the gift. Still, marking the day with a small token of affection can mean a lot to you as a couple.

For that reason, we are here to suggest three last-minute anniversary gift ideas. They are so simple that you don’t have to think in advance.

Things to Consider

Every couple is different, and your gift should reflect your relationship. Still, when buying a present for your anniversary, there are some aspects you could consider so you would get it right.

First of all, although anniversaries are shared celebrations, don’t be selfish. Think about the things your spouse enjoys or the activities you two like doing together.

Besides, your inside jokes, fond memories, and plans for the future can be pools of inspiration for the gift. Remember that you’re buying something for the person you love, though. You don’t have to like the present as long as you know they will.

Date Night

Gifts don’t always need to be material. If you’ve found yourself struggling for ideas last minute, or you and your partner made a deal not to get each other gifts, you could surprise them with a date night for just the two of you.

What you do entirely depends on who you are as a couple. You could recreate your first date, cook a hearty meal at home, or take them out on a picnic.

Moreover, you could explore the events happening near you on that day. If you run into something both of you would love, but usually don’t have time for, it could feel like a small getaway in the middle of the workweek.

Photo Album

Perhaps not as quick as the previous two, a photo album with your shared memories is the most thoughtful on the list. Besides, you can make it in a day – choose your favorite photos, make physical copies, and put them in a small folder.

In the age of digital photography, a token such as this one will stand out. You could also get a larger album for you two to fill out together in years to come.
